Delivery
A website release should protect the current search and conversion system while improving the experience.
Inventory routes, metadata, analytics, forms, rankings and performance before design or migration decisions.
Define audience journeys, sitemap, content model, components, integrations and conversion events.
Implement responsive frontend, CMS and integrations with accessibility and performance considered during development.
Test redirects, canonicals, schema, forms, attribution, analytics, mobile layouts and critical performance paths.
Launch with a protected URL plan and review search, errors, conversion and performance after release.

Website development centers on public content, CMS, experience, conversion, performance and technical SEO. Custom software centers on application workflows, permissions, business logic, data and deeper product architecture.

Yes. A redesign does not require URL changes. Existing URLs should be preserved unless there is a documented reason to consolidate or replace them.
